Jin Shengtan once recorded thirty-three happy things in "The Romance of the West Chamber". I can only recall all the joys in life, but they are all trivial and can't be mentioned. However, there is still residual joy when I recall them, which is true happiness. It is a great pleasure to imitate Jin Shengtan's works now, and let's talk about them.
First, there is a letter. It is not a bank statement or an e-commerce advertisement, but a letter from a friend. What a joy!
First, wake up in the middle of the night, all the walls are silent, the bright moon enters the window, half of the room is bright and clear, the light flows like water, not a single dust is disturbed, and you can rest from all your worries. What a joy!
First, I am so happy to hear that Gaotang, thousands of miles away, has recovered from his illness as before!
First, I will be late for work, and the bus will be gone, and I can’t catch it. Suddenly another car came up, and there were many empty seats in the car, so I got on calmly. What a joy!
First, throw away all the clothes that are not suitable for wearing, never wear, rarely wear, or may be worn, and hope that the wardrobe will be empty and the body and mind will be comfortable. What a joy!
First, you can be alone at home and do whatever you want. Cook instant noodles with various eggs, vegetables and mushrooms. What a joy!
First, what a joy it is to give something as a gift and be cherished by others!
First, the clutter accumulates like a mountain day by day and has been covered with dust for a long time. There is no place clean in the small room. One day, there was no one at home, so I had to clean up alone. I started to finish the work in the evening, and then I felt that I had not eaten and had not rested. I was exhausted, but I looked around and everything was in order, and everything was clear and clear. What a joy!
First, I accidentally bought five bets on the double-color ball. I was happy to win the last prize of twenty and five yuan. I used the bonus to buy five more bets without asking the result. What a joy!
First, it snowed heavily one day in elementary school and I couldn’t go home for lunch. I was so hungry that I unexpectedly took out two cents from my pocket and bought a loaf of bread, which I thought was the most delicious thing in the world. What a joy!
First, it has been hazy for days, strong winds have arisen at night, the fog has dispersed, the sky has opened, and the moon is bright and the stars are sparse. What a joy!
First, on the eve of the beginning of spring, I suddenly smelled a faint fragrance while reading. I looked up and saw a narcissus on the table, one of which was half blooming. Then there is a poem: "The beauty is beginning to show in the middle of the night, and a branch is testing the spring. The fragrance grows in a quiet place, so there is no need to be ashamed of being close."
